temu如何打开前端

temu如何打开前端

TEMU如何打开前端:使用开发者工具、管理依赖、配置文件设置

要在TEMU中打开前端,首先需要理解一些基本步骤和工具。使用开发者工具管理依赖配置文件设置是关键的步骤。本文将详细介绍如何使用这些步骤,帮助你在TEMU中顺利打开前端。

一、使用开发者工具

在开发前端时,开发者工具是必不可少的。浏览器自带的开发者工具(如Chrome DevTools)可以帮助你调试和优化前端代码。

1. Chrome DevTools的使用

Chrome DevTools是一个强大的工具,提供了多种功能,帮助开发者更快地调试和优化代码。打开Chrome浏览器,按下 Ctrl+Shift+I(Windows) 或 Cmd+Option+I(Mac)即可打开开发者工具。主要功能包括:

  • 元素面板:查看和修改页面的HTML和CSS。
  • 控制台:运行JavaScript代码并查看输出。
  • 网络面板:监控网络请求,查看加载时间和资源。
  • 性能面板:分析页面的性能,找出瓶颈。

2. 使用其他浏览器开发者工具

除了Chrome DevTools,其他浏览器(如Firefox、Safari、Edge)也提供了类似的开发者工具。它们的使用方法大同小异,可以根据个人习惯选择。

二、管理依赖

在前端开发中,管理依赖是一个非常重要的环节。常见的依赖管理工具包括npm和yarn。

1. 使用npm

npm是Node.js的包管理器,用于安装、管理和发布JavaScript包。以下是一些基本命令:

  • npm init:初始化项目,生成 package.json 文件。
  • npm install <package>:安装依赖包。
  • npm run <script>:运行定义在 package.json 中的脚本。

2. 使用yarn

yarn是Facebook推出的一个快速、可靠和安全的依赖管理工具。以下是一些基本命令:

  • yarn init:初始化项目,生成 package.json 文件。
  • yarn add <package>:安装依赖包。
  • yarn run <script>:运行定义在 package.json 中的脚本。

三、配置文件设置

配置文件是前端项目的核心,用于定义各种参数和选项。常见的配置文件包括 .babelrcwebpack.config.jstsconfig.json 等。

1. 配置Babel

Babel是一个JavaScript编译器,用于将ES6+代码转译为兼容性更好的ES5代码。以下是一个基本的 .babelrc 配置文件:

{

"presets": ["@babel/preset-env", "@babel/preset-react"]

}

2. 配置Webpack

Webpack是一个前端资源打包工具,用于将各种模块(JavaScript、CSS、图片等)打包成一个或多个文件。以下是一个基本的 webpack.config.js 配置文件:

const path = require('path');

module.exports = {

entry: './src/index.js',

output: {

filename: 'bundle.js',

path: path.resolve(__dirname, 'dist')

},

module: {

rules: [

{

test: /.js$/,

exclude: /node_modules/,

use: {

loader: 'babel-loader'

}

}

]

},

devServer: {

contentBase: './dist',

hot: true

}

};

四、项目结构和文件组织

一个良好的项目结构和文件组织可以提高开发效率和代码可维护性。以下是一个常见的前端项目结构:

my-project/

├── public/

│ ├── index.html

│ └── ...

├── src/

│ ├── components/

│ │ ├── App.js

│ │ └── ...

│ │

│ ├── styles/

│ │ ├── main.css

│ │ └── ...

│ │

│ ├── index.js

│ └── ...

├── package.json

├── webpack.config.js

└── ...

1. public 目录

public 目录用于存放静态资源,如HTML文件、图片等。在开发环境中,Webpack DevServer会提供这些资源。

2. src 目录

src 目录用于存放源代码。将代码按功能模块划分,如 componentsstyles 等,有助于提高代码的可读性和可维护性。

五、使用版本控制系统

版本控制系统(如Git)是前端开发中不可或缺的工具。它可以帮助你跟踪代码的变化,协作开发,并在出现问题时回滚到之前的版本。

1. 初始化Git仓库

在项目根目录下运行 git init 命令,初始化一个Git仓库。然后创建一个 .gitignore 文件,忽略不需要跟踪的文件和目录:

node_modules/

dist/

.env

2. 提交代码

使用 git add . 命令将所有更改添加到暂存区,然后使用 git commit -m "Initial commit" 命令提交代码。

六、使用项目管理工具

在前端开发中,项目管理工具可以帮助你更好地组织和跟踪任务。推荐使用以下两个系统:

1. 研发项目管理系统PingCode

PingCode是一款专为研发团队设计的项目管理工具,提供了丰富的功能,如任务管理、需求跟踪、缺陷管理等。它支持敏捷开发流程,帮助团队提高开发效率。

2. 通用项目协作软件Worktile

Worktile是一款通用的项目协作软件,适用于各种类型的团队。它提供了任务管理、文档管理、时间管理等功能,帮助团队更好地协作和沟通。

七、持续集成和部署

持续集成(CI)和持续部署(CD)是现代前端开发流程的重要组成部分。通过自动化构建、测试和部署,可以提高代码质量和发布效率。

1. 使用CI工具

常见的CI工具包括Jenkins、Travis CI、CircleCI等。它们可以帮助你自动化构建和测试流程,确保代码的质量和稳定性。

2. 部署到服务器

前端代码通常需要部署到Web服务器上。常见的部署工具和平台包括:

  • Netlify:一个免费的静态网站托管服务,支持自动化构建和部署。
  • Vercel:一个现代化的前端部署平台,支持多种框架和静态网站生成器。
  • AWS S3:一个对象存储服务,可以用于托管静态网站。

八、安全性和性能优化

在前端开发中,安全性和性能优化是两个非常重要的方面。通过合理的安全措施和性能优化,可以提高用户体验和网站的可靠性。

1. 安全性

前端安全性主要包括防止XSS攻击、CSRF攻击、SQL注入等。常见的安全措施包括:

  • 输入验证:对用户输入的数据进行验证和过滤,防止恶意代码注入。
  • HTTPS:使用HTTPS协议,确保数据传输的安全性。
  • 内容安全策略(CSP):通过设置CSP头,防止XSS攻击。

2. 性能优化

前端性能优化主要包括减少加载时间、提高渲染速度等。常见的优化方法包括:

  • 代码分割:将代码按需加载,减少初始加载时间。
  • 图片优化:使用合适的图片格式和压缩工具,减少图片大小。
  • 缓存:使用浏览器缓存和CDN,减少服务器请求次数。

通过以上步骤和方法,你可以在TEMU中顺利打开前端,并进行有效的开发和优化。希望本文能够帮助你更好地理解和实践前端开发的相关知识。

相关问答FAQs:

1. 什么是Temu前端?如何打开Temu前端?
Temu前端是一种用于开发和运行Web应用程序的工具。要打开Temu前端,首先确保您已经安装了Temu的最新版本。然后,打开您喜欢的文本编辑器,并使用Temu的命令行工具创建一个新的项目。在项目文件夹中,您可以找到一个名为"index.html"的文件,用任何现代浏览器打开它即可。

2. 如何在Temu前端中创建一个新的页面?
要在Temu前端中创建一个新的页面,您可以在项目文件夹中创建一个新的HTML文件。然后,在新的HTML文件中添加所需的HTML,CSS和JavaScript代码。最后,通过在项目的主页面(通常是"index.html")中添加一个链接,将新页面与主页面链接起来。

3. 如何在Temu前端中调试代码?
在Temu前端中调试代码非常简单。首先,确保您的代码中没有语法错误。然后,使用Temu的开发者工具来检查和调试您的代码。在浏览器中打开Temu前端应用程序后,按下F12键,将打开开发者工具。在开发者工具中,您可以查看控制台输出、检查元素、调试JavaScript代码等,以找到并解决问题。

原创文章,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/2192800

(0)
Edit1Edit1
上一篇 12小时前
下一篇 12小时前
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部